THE Discovery of India, a book well known to millions of readers, was written by India’s former Prime Minister, Jawahar Lal Nehru, while he was imprisoned at Ahmednagar Fort in Maharashtra. In this book, Jawahar Lal Nehru emphasized the virtue of the scientific temper in these memorable lines: “The scientific approach and temper are, or should be, a way of life, a process of thinking, a method of thinking, a method of acting and associating with our fellow men.”
What is the scientific temper? The scientific temper is a frame of mind based on reality, which demands the application of logic in all situations. This quality is of prime importance. It is indispensible for every individual and every group of people if they are to be successful in life.
Scientific temper makes you a positive thinker and dictates a realistic approach. It makes you a giving member of society.

It ensures that your mind develops along the right lines and makes you a creative thinker. One who possesses a scientific temper, being an integrated personality, never suffers from a superiority complex or the arrogance which would lead to the kind of bias and hatred that stems from unhealthy thought.
Scientific temperament is basic to all kinds of human activities, both individual and social. It makes one patient, tolerant and forgiving. Only those who are imbued with such a spirit can be good members of their societies. While scientific temper gives one everything, it deprives one of nothing. Without it, a man is no better than an animal, while once possessed of it, he emerges as a true human being.
